Every crate we supply is 100% IATA approved. Whether you have a dog, cat, bird or anything in between, we will ensure all IATA requirements are met, making your pets journey safe and comfortable.
When choosing your crate, your pet should be able to comfortably stand without the top of their head or ears touching the crate. They should be able to turn around and lie down. Below are images of Pet Travel crates that are NOT airline approved and will NOT be accepted for travel.

Not Airline Approved
Collapsable wire crates are not airline approved

Not Airline Approved
Crates with wheels attached are not airline approved.

Not Airline Approved
Crates with ventilation holes larger than 19cm x 19cm for cats and 2.5cm x 2.5cm for dogs are not airline approved

Not Airline Approved
Soft Pet Carriers are not airline approved for manifested cargo.

Not Airline Approved
Crates with top openings and without a spring-loaded door are not airline approved.

All Care Approved Crate
Must have a spring-loaded front door.
Must be bolted together, top to bottom.
Ventilation holes must be no larger that 19cm x 19cm for cats and 2.5cm x 2.5cm for dogs.
Must be a rigid plastic material, in good condition.
Water bowl must be affixed onto the inside of the crate (as shown above).
Wheels must be removed.
